- 1、本文档共11页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
Python基本语法3
1234列表元祖字典集合
1列表12列表的数据项可以具有相同的类型看作一个容器,大小和值可变有索引创建列表:1)List()2)把逗号分隔的不同的数据项使用[]号括增加元素ls.append()更新元素ls[i]=4删除元素del(ls[i])查/切片ls[0:2]ls[:4]操作符运算:in、notin+*列表特点列表操作存储数据的合理方式,你知道吗?
2元祖Python的长期…….Python的故事…….你的故事?12元祖tuple看作只读的列表元组使用小括号(),列表使用方括号[]创建元祖:tup=()tup1=tuple()tup2=(1,physics’)注意:tup3=(1)看作是一个运算符()正确方式:tup3=(1,)思考:如何更改元祖中的元素转化函数list()tuple()合理存储,保证数据安全?
3字典字典是另一种可变容器模型,且可存储任意类型对象。字典的每个键值key=value对用冒号:分割,每个键值对之间用逗号,分割,整个字典包括在花括号{}中,格式如下所示:dic1={key1:value1,key2:value2}dic2={}dict1={a:1,b:2,b:3’}dict1#?3.值可以取任何数据类型,但键必须是不可变的,如字符串,数字或元组。4.键唯一,二值可以相同中华字典,文化自信的来源!
3字典字典操作1.查元素值dict1={Name:Zara,Age:7,Class:First’}print(dict1[Name]:,dict1[Name’])print(dict1[Age]:,dict1[Age’])forkeyindict1:print(key,dict1[key],sep=:’)2.增加元素dict1[‘Address’]=‘nanjin’3.删除元素del(dict1[Name]#删除键是Name的条目dict1.clear()#清空字典所有条目del(dict1)#删除字典4.修改元素dict[Age]=8
3字典序号函数及描述1dict.clear()删除字典内所有元素2dict.copy()返回一个字典的浅复制3dict.fromkeys()创建一个新字典,以序列seq中元素作字典的键,val为字典所有键对应的初始值4dict.get(key,default=None)返回指定键的值,如果值不在字典中返回default值5dict.has_key(key)如果键在字典dict里返回true,否则返回false6dict.items()以列表返回可遍历的(键,值)元组数组7dict.keys()以列表返回一个字典所有的键8dict.setdefault(key,default=None)和get()类似,但如果键不已经存在于字典中,将会添加键并将值设为default9dict.update(dict2)把字典dict2的键/值对更新到dict里10dict.values()以列表返回字典中的所有值11cmp(dict1,dict2)比较两个字典元素。12len(dict)计算字典元素个数,即键的总数。13str(dict)输出字典可打印的字符串表示。14type(dict)返回输入的变量类型,如果变量是字典就返回字典类型。
4集合添加元素set1.add(x)set1.updata(args=混合类型)删除元素set1.remove(x)set1.pop()更新元素没有索引,也没键值对,故没有更新。查看元素遍历查看forxinset1:
print(x)说明:集合也是可变对象,但元素的值不能相同,没有索引和键的概念,集合是无序的,但它本身是有序存到的。如果用参数创建一个集合,该参数必须是可以迭代的类型。集合没有特别的定义符号,但可以通过{}或set函数来创建:set0={1,2,3,4}set1=set()set2=set([range(0,10)])set3=set(“hai!”)set4=set((1,2,3,4))个体与集体,唯一与群生的统一!
4集合st或者s.intersection(t) 返回集合的交集。s|t或者s.union(t) 返回两个集合的并集s-
您可能关注的文档
- 临床监察英文面试题及答案2025必威体育精装版版.docx
- 临床护理面试题及答案2025必威体育精装版版.docx
- 临床概要期末试题及答案2025必威体育精装版版.docx
- 关联借款协议.doc
- 临床技能试题简答题2025必威体育精装版版.docx
- 临床护士小技能操作试题2025必威体育精装版版.docx
- Xbar-S管制图 (1)经典经典经典.xlsx
- nP管制图 (2)经典经典经典.xlsx
- 1_MSA-Kappa分析经典经典经典.xlsx
- 2023年考研英语二真题及答案.pdf
- 2025辽宁沈阳汽车有限公司所属企业沈阳金杯李尔汽车座椅有限公司招聘5人笔试备考题库附答案详解(突破.docx
- 2025辽宁沈阳城市建设投资集团所属企业沈阳国际工程咨询集团有限公司招聘11人笔试备考试题附答案详解.docx
- 2025重庆市渝中区大坪街道社区卫生服务中心招聘2人笔试模拟试题及一套答案详解.docx
- 2025辽宁沈阳汽车有限公司所属企业招聘招聘笔试备考试题及答案详解(精选题).docx
- 2025辽宁沈阳汽车有限公司招聘8人考前自测高频考点模拟试题附答案详解(模拟题).docx
- 2025辽宁沈阳汽车有限公司招聘8人笔试模拟试题附答案详解(典型题).docx
- 2025辽宁沈阳通联达商贸有限公司招聘1人笔试参考题库附答案解析参考答案详解.docx
- 2025辽宁沈阳通联达商贸有限公司招聘1人笔试备考试题及答案详解(全优).docx
- 2025辽宁沈阳空港物流有限公司招聘2人笔试模拟试题精选答案详解.docx
- 饮食健康,从我做起-让我们一起探索健康饮食的秘密.pptx
最近下载
- 医院手术分级目录.xls VIP
- 《增强小学生英语口语能力的实践与研究》结题报告.docx VIP
- 糖尿病饮食的实施糖尿病饮食治疗.pptx VIP
- (高清版)-B-T 34590.1-2022 道路车辆 功能安全 第1部分:术语.pdf VIP
- 餐饮业员工流失现状及解决对策研究——以季季红餐饮管理有限公司为例.doc VIP
- 电泳电压、时间与膜厚关系的试验与探讨.pdf VIP
- 材料电化学教学(浙大)电化学测试基础知识.pdf VIP
- 银行合规内控管理体系建设项目实施建议书.docx VIP
- 天线与电波传播天线基础知识.pptx VIP
- 2025年质量员-土建方向-通用基础(质量员)证考试题库及答案.pdf VIP
文档评论(0)